CLIP NASTY: TNA Does What WWE May or May Not Have Tried to Do
__________________________________________________________________________TNA fired a moderately successful counter punch to WWE for the first time in quite some time. Hailing this past week’s Impact as a show packing the biggest surprise of the year, TNA surely didn’t disappoint (for their standards) as it aired a 3/3/11 vignette towards the end of the show, similar to WWE’s 2/21/11 vignettes that sparked assumptions and hysteria that Sting would finally be coming to WWE.
Make no mistake about it, this is not TNA copying WWE, but rather the second-rate promotion is mocking WWE for failing do deliver on a rumored coup that would have lead to Vince McMahon officially being recognized as the omnipotent Emperor of wrestling who has ruled over every big name the past few generations had to offer. Sadly, for him, Sting still remains as one of the very few wrestlers who never ever set foot in any reincarnation WWE.
With Booker T and Kevin Nash defecting for WWE last month, opting instead to hit the ring at the 2011 Royal Rumble and in Booker T’s case do color commentary (poorly), it’s nice to see the little guy score a moral victory – Although let’s not get all bloggy and emotional about such a feel good moment for a non-mainstream entity.
